Course OutlineI. Polymer Parameters
Molecular weight distribution; Chemical composition; Isomerism; Morphology; Additives; Price.
II. Step GrowthKinetics and molecular weight; Equilibrium considerations – open vs. closed system; Polyesters; Polyamides; Polyurethanes; Engineering Polymers.
III. Chain GrowthFree radical; Copolymerizations; Anionic (living polymerizations, block
copolymers, graft copolymers, thermoplastic elastomers); Cationic; Polyolefins; Ring-opening polymerization.
VI. Thermosetting SystemsKinetics, gel point, TTT diagrams; Epoxies
V. Special TopicsPolymers for use in microelectronics; polymers used for electronics and
photonics; drug delivery and biomaterials; Security/military
